
Flora-Bama Ole River Grill
No description available
Upcoming Events
Flora-Bama Ole River Grill
Sun, June 29, 2025 01:00 PM
Flora-Bama Ole River Grill
Wed, June 25, 2025 05:00 PM
Flora-Bama Ole River Grill
Tue, June 24, 2025 05:00 PM